use crate::{QueueServiceClient, QueueServiceProperties};
use azure_core::{headers::Headers, xml::read_xml, Method, Response as AzureResponse};
use azure_storage::headers::CommonStorageResponseHeaders;
use std::convert::TryInto;
operation! {
GetQueueServiceProperties,
client: QueueServiceClient,
}
impl GetQueueServicePropertiesBuilder {
pub fn into_future(mut self) -> GetQueueServiceProperties {
Box::pin(async move {
let mut url = self.client.url()?.clone();
url.query_pairs_mut().append_pair("restype", "service");
url.query_pairs_mut().append_pair("comp", "properties");
let mut request =
self.client
.finalize_request(url, Method::Get, Headers::new(), None)?;
let response = self.client.send(&mut self.context, &mut request).await?;
GetQueueServicePropertiesResponse::try_from(response).await
})
}
}
#[derive(Debug, Clone)]
pub struct GetQueueServicePropertiesResponse {
pub common_storage_response_headers: CommonStorageResponseHeaders,
pub queue_service_properties: QueueServiceProperties,
}
impl GetQueueServicePropertiesResponse {
async fn try_from(response: AzureResponse) -> azure_core::Result<Self> {
let (_, headers, body) = response.deconstruct();
let body = body.collect().await?;
let queue_service_properties: QueueServiceProperties = read_xml(&body)?;
Ok(GetQueueServicePropertiesResponse {
common_storage_response_headers: (&headers).try_into()?,
queue_service_properties,
})
}
}
